Consider how HDR (High Dynamic Range) rendering transforms lighting realism—expanding the contrast between light and shadow amplifies emotional tone, guiding attention and intensifying narrative moments. Likewise, anti-aliasing smooths jagged edges, reducing visual fatigue during extended sessions and preserving the player’s focus. These systems don’t just improve image quality; they support a sustained psychological state of presence, where the player feels genuinely embedded in the game world. The cognitive impact is measurable: studies show that consistent visual feedback increases perceived control, reinforcing a sense of agency and emotional investment. When games maintain visual coherence across environments and actions, players develop deeper emotional attachments, recognizing subtle environmental cues as storytelling devices rather than technical artifacts.
Visual settings also serve as silent storytellers. In open-world games, dynamic weather systems paired with adaptive lighting cue players to narrative shifts—gloomy skies signaling danger, bright sunlight marking moments of clarity or triumph. Atmospheric effects such as fog, depth-of-field, and volumetric light scattering reinforce spatial believability, making environments feel three-dimensional and tangible. These cues guide attention without explicit UI prompts, allowing narrative pacing to unfold naturally. For example, in The Last of Us Part II, the meticulous use of ambient lighting and environmental shadows immerses players in a world of emotional weight and moral complexity, where every visual detail supports storytelling intent. Beyond aesthetics, visual settings profoundly affect accessibility and inclusivity. Customizable profiles—allowing adjustments to contrast, color saturation, and UI opacity—enable players with visual sensitivities or neurodivergence to tailor experiences safely. High-fidelity modes can be balanced with performance-optimized alternatives that preserve core immersion, ensuring broad accessibility without sacrificing design integrity. This thoughtful layering of settings reflects a deeper commitment: immersion isn’t just for the visually acute, but for every player seeking connection.
